WebMay 24, 2024 · DWP have confirmed that the £350 ‘thank you’ payment to households in the UK who accommodate someone fleeing the conflict in Ukraine under the Homes for Ukraine Scheme will not affect their universal credit award. DWP say the £350 payment will be treated as unearned income and disregarded for universal credit purposes. hide a hook
